I was delighted to see an unfamiliar track by MGMT on the front page of The Hype Machine today only to find out it was one of TWO leaked tracks from MGMT’s newest creation Congratulations.

Congratulations drops April 8th, but these tracks make for a satisfactory preview. Now that everyone in their mothers know the first nine or ten do-do-dos of ‘Kids,’ it’s time to hear a new sound from these boys. And I have to say I like what I hear.

‘Flash Delirium’ has a nice, matured sound that is reminiscent of Of Montreal and Hot Chip. It seems they’ve taken more driving elements from Oracular Spectacular (i.e. ’4th Dimension Transition’ and ‘Of Moons, Birds & Monsters’) and refined them a bit with this breezy, mystical feel.

‘Congratulations’ is a little slower, a ballad if you will, but there’s something simultaneously soothing and psychedelic about it.
